Get Supported File Types

This REST API allows getting a list of all file formats supported by GroupDocs.Parser Cloud product.

Resources

The following GroupDocs.Parser Cloud REST API resource has been used in the get supported file types example.

HTTP POST ~~/formats

cURL example

The following example demonstrates how to get supported file types.

# First get JSON Web Token
# Please get your Client Id and Client Secret from https://dashboard.groupdocs.cloud/applications.
# The environment variables CLIENT_ID and CLIENT_SECRET must be set.
curl -v 'https://api.groupdocs.cloud/connect/token' \
  -X POST \
  -d 'grant_type=client_credentials&client_id=$CLIENT_ID&client_secret=$CLIENT_SECRET' \
  -H 'Content-Type: application/x-www-form-urlencoded' \
  -H 'Accept: application/json'

# cURL example to get document information
curl -v 'https://api.groupdocs.cloud/v1.0/parser/formats' \
  -X GET \
  -H 'Content-Type: application/json' \
  -H 'Accept: application/json' \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$JWT_TOKEN"

{
  "formats": [    
    {
      "extension": ".doc",
      "fileFormat": "Microsoft Word Document"
    },
    {
      "extension": ".docm",
      "fileFormat": "Word Open XML Macro-Enabled Document"
    },
    {
      "extension": ".docx",
      "fileFormat": "Microsoft Word Open XML Document"
    },
    ...
    {
      "extension": ".xlsx",
      "fileFormat": "Microsoft Excel Open XML Spreadsheet"
    }
  ]
}
